About The Position

The North Carolina Department of Natural and Cultural Resources (DNCR) manages over 100 locations across the state, including historic sites, museums, parks, aquariums, and various programs related to natural and cultural resources. Its vision is to be a leader in using the state's resources to build North Carolina's social, cultural, educational, and economic future. The Atlantic Conservation Coalition (ACC) program, a multi-state coalition including North Carolina, South Carolina, Virginia, and Maryland, aims to increase carbon sequestration by protecting and restoring forests, wetlands, and coastal habitats. This program requires quality assurance and control for the environmental assessment and monitoring of carbon benefits. This position, a Program Analyst I (NS), is a time-limited, hybrid telework eligible role located at 109 East Jones Street, Raleigh, NC 27601, with a typical work schedule of Monday-Friday, 8-5, 40 hours a week. It is subject to funding availability and may last up to 36 months, with eligible State Benefits. The ACC office oversees the implementation of the Climate Pollution Reduction Grant (CPRG) award from the U.S. Environmental Protection Agency and Governor Cooper's Executive Order 305, proposing 21 projects to protect and restore high-carbon coastal habitats and peatlands and promote sustainable forestry management.

Responsibilities

  • Providing expert QA and QA data assistance to organizational staff.
  • Quality Assurance for data and document control, including QAPP tracking and maintaining other records of pertinent Quality Program activities.
  • Coordinates data working group meetings and facilitates integration of data quality information from project managers and partner organizations.
  • Addressing Coalition Member, contractor, EPA and other QAPP input and collaborate with the QAM in submitting final quality documents for approval by the EPA.
  • Providing support to the Quality Assurance Manager (QAM) in oversight of QA/QC environmental program and implementation, including identifying and providing QA Training.
  • Collaborates with the QAM to conduct assessments and review environmental data.
